The Waltons Season 4 Episode 8
A handsome forestry student name Chad Marshall arrives on Walton’s Mountain. Both Erin and Mary Ellen are smitten and a competition delelops between them. Each is sure that she is the chosen one. Mary Ellen realizes that it is Erin thats truly in love.
Serie: The Waltons
Episode Title: The Competition
Air Date: 1975-10-30
